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
475200061 38294656868 1140 3914 00676207214
618 74028111065
618 74028111065
2013621570 572 7134
All about undefined
Interested in learning more?
618 74028111065
2013621570 572 7134
See more
38 56606
953973 700863 891121
See more
55294654 1057442684
19 99 50967305040
See more